Involving the rolling of a die. Assume that the die is weighted so that the probability of a 1 is 0.2, the probability of a 2 is 0.2, the probability of a 3 is 0.3, the probability of a 4 is 0.1, the probability of a 5 is 0.1, and the probability of a 6 is 0.1. You roll the die until the sum of all numbers which have appeared exceeds 3. A random variable X is defined to be the number of rolls. Complete the Probability Density Function Table without rounding the answers.
